NORTHAMPTON, Mass (WWLP) - The Northwestern District Attorney's office has identified the bicyclist who was seriously injured after being hit by a car in Northampton Saturday night.
18 year old Harry Delmolino of Hadley remains in critical condition at Baystate Medical Center tonight.
At around 7:45 Saturday night he was riding his bike east on Main Street in downtown Northampton.
A car driven by Celso Avelar, 43, of Northampton, turned left onto Pleasant Street from Main Street, that's when the two collided.
Delmolino was hit and thrown off his bike onto the pavement.
The spokeswoman for the Northwestern DA's office told 22News he was not wearing a helmet.
The accident remains under investigation.
